The ingredients needed to make Oil-free and Egg-free Tofu Brownies:
- Prepare 40 grams ☆Cake flour
- Take 15 grams ☆Strong bread flour
- Take 25 grams ☆Cocoa powder
- Get 1/2 tsp ☆Baking powder
- Make ready 100 grams Silken tofu (not drained)
- Prepare 1/2 tsp Miso (Hatcho miso)
- Get 2 tbsp Marmalade
- Prepare 3 tbsp Maple syrup
- Prepare 1 dash Vanilla beans or vanilla essence (optional)
- Prepare 20 grams Walnuts (optional)
- Prepare 1 tbsp Orange peel (if you have it, if not increase the marmalade jam to 3 tablespoons)
Steps to make Oil-free and Egg-free Tofu Brownies:
- Add the powder ingredients marked with ☆ to a bowl and mix together with a whisk. If you have time, roast the walnuts for 5 minutes at 180℃ and finely chop. Preheat the oven to 180℃.
- In a separate bowl, cream together the tofu and miso.
- Add the marmalade, maple syrup, orange peel and vanilla beans to the bowl from Step 2 and mix in well.
- Add the contents of the bowl from Step 2 into the bowl from Step 1 all at once and mix in gently with a rubber spatula. Add in the walnuts whilst the mixture is still lumpy.
- Line a pound cake tin with parchment paper and pour in the mixture. Level out the surface and bake for 18-20 minutes at 180℃.
- For this design, I cut out a heart-shaped piece of paper with a cutter and rested it on the center of the brownie. I then sifted powdered sugar over the top.
- Simple version without orange: Take away the marmalade and orange peel and instead use 4 1/2 tablespoons maple syrup, 1/2 tablespoon water.
